From Conversations to Systems
Casual prompts work once.
Product-grade prompts work every time.
The difference is structure.
A product-grade prompt:
- Defines a role
- Sets clear objectives
- Controls tone and format
- Handles variation in inputs
- Produces consistent outputs
This is the difference between:
- Asking AI for help
- And building with AI
One Prompt Can Become Many Products
Here’s something most people don’t realize:
A single well-designed prompt can power:
- Prompt packs
- Custom GPTs
- Widgets
- Mini tools
- Industry-specific assistants
You don’t need 50 prompts.
You need one good system.
Change the audience.
Change the output format.
Change the constraints.
The core intelligence stays the same.
That’s leverage.
